Biceps tendonitis: In individuals over age 40 tendon problems of the rotator cuff and biceps increase. The biceps frequently causes pain in front of the shoulder (anterior) and with instability of the biceps is made worse by arm rotation and and by lifting with the palm up in front of you. When severe, it can rupture which usually removes the pain. The profile of the biceps drops down but function is preserved.
